Dental coverage is available 2 ways. Health plans with dental coverage: Some Marketplace health plans have dental coverage. You can see which plans include dental coverage when you compare them. If a health plan includes dental, the premium covers both health and dental coverage. Separate dental plans: In some cases, separate dental plans are ...

Español. Some small employers in Texas offer health insurance to their employees. Note: Texas insurance law defines a small employer as a business with two to 50 employees, regardless of how many hours the employees work. If you provide health insurance, you must offer it to all your employees who work 30 hours or more each week.Helping them stay healthy, happy and productive is part of your job – and great benefits make that easier. Takealong Dental High. ... $2,000 per person per calendar year: $1,500 per person per calendar year: None: Annual Cleaning: Pays 100% of maximum allowable charge: …Lingual (back-of-tooth) metal braces: $8,000–$10,000. Ceramic braces: $4,000–$8,000. Invisalign: $3,000–$8,000. Many dental plans will cover part of the costs of braces. Plans typically cover up to 50% of the cost for pediatric braces, with a lifetime maximum of $1,500 per child. You don't usually pay taxes on insurance payouts. For adults who purchase their own stand-alone or family dental coverage through the exchange, premiums range from $18 to $109 per month. IHC Specialty Benefits reports that the average monthly premium for a stand-alone family dental plan sold in Texas in 2022 was $47.18. A self-purchased dental plan for a single adult will tend to cost somewhere between $10 and $70 per month. If a plan has a very low premium, be aware that it might be a dental discount plan, or it might only cover preventive care. As …Delta Dental Elite 3500. This dental insurance plan is similar to the Elite 1000; however, you will get a plan year maximum of $3,500. The deductible is only $50 per person.
